KAUFER v. BECCARIS


401 Pa.Super. 1 (1991)

584 A.2d 357

Frieda KAUFER and Irvin Kaufer and Carolyn Kaufer, His Wife, d/b/a Kaufer Brothers, a partnership, Appellants, v. John BECCARIS, Appellee.

Superior Court of Pennsylvania.

Filed January 4, 1991.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Robert Gawlas, Wilkes-Barre, for appellants.

Cynthia R. Vullo, Wilkes-Barre, for appellee.

Before WIEAND, DEL SOLE and MONTEMURO, JJ.


WIEAND, Judge:

John Beccaris has conducted a retail shoe business since 1946 on lots Nos. 1 to 5 South Main Street, Plains, Luzerne County, and has owned the real estate since 1956. On adjoining land at Nos. 7 to 11 Main Street, a retail hardware business, known as Kaufer Brothers, has been conducted since 1929.
